EQ.TXT contains useful EQ.COM program data and, if you don't have MASM, an uncommented SCR program for assembling EQ.COM using DEBUG.EXE (MS-DOS). See EQ.ASM for additional information.
EQ.COM is a small, 869 byte DOS command line conversion utility that automatically displays all valid equivalents of bases 2, 8, 10 and 16. Since it classifies the intrinsic base of a %1 number...
EQ.ASM was written with MASM (Ver 6.1). See EQ.TXT for comprehensive details concerning the EQ.COM program.

This is MS-DOS debugger just like SYMDEB.EXE which supports 386
instructions. The reason why I made this software is
SYMDEB.EXE(Microsoft provided before) does not support 386
instructions.
